ABSG Consulting is seeking a Budget Analyst.

What You Will Do:

  • Perform studies, analyses, and evaluations related to business information and financial systems, such as requirements analyses, feasibility studies, and cost/benefit analyses

  • Analyze, forecast, monitor, and summarize financial data for the management of the contract

  • Prepare and submit financial information for reports and data calls; review, monitor, and manage budgets; apply financial analysis, cost estimation, accounting, cost accounting standards; and invoicing knowledge.

  • Provide the full range of financial functions for major system development including should‐cost and projected cost analysis and trade studies related to cost trade‐off options

  • Define established financial business practices for integration into the client's financial business system; Identify potential problems and recommend solutions through analysis

  • Work with functional specialists, automation specialists, contractors, vendors, and clients to effectively translate the client's requirements into an automated application

  • Apply state‐of‐the‐art tools and processes to effectively automate financial applications in the most effective manner while adhering to the established accounting principles and practices

What You Will Need:

Education and Experience

  • 10 years' experience in related discipline

  • Bachelor's degree from an accredited school in any business-related subject area (Accounting, Finance, Economics)

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ities

  • Experience with budget analysis, and business information and financial systems

  • Background in financial functions, including cost analyses, requirements analysis, feasibility studies, and cost/benefit analysis
